## Deployment

Vellum's template rendering is the main CPU cost in production. We precompile all templates at container startup, which adds roughly eight seconds to boot but cuts p95 render latency by half. Do not disable precompilation except in local dev. Cache sizes and worker counts were tuned during the Harrowgate load tests, so change them only with a benchmark run. The values currently shipped to production are as follows.

service settings:
novath:
  pin: 1396
  tenant: pelys
  seal: seal_ccc035e1
  metrics_host: metrics.novath.qorvelworks.test
  standby_team: fraeth
  escalation: drueth-zorok
  nonce: 61d508

Orders table in Tarnwick uses soft deletes — deleted_at column, never hard-delete rows. All queries must filter on it; the OrderScope helper does this automatically. Purge job runs monthly, 90-day retention. Don't run ad-hoc deletes in prod. If you need to restore a purged snapshot from the cold archive, the recovery passphrase follows.

strongbox words: wenix-ulador

- [ ] **Step 7: Breaker override escrow.** After sealing the signing keys for the Tallgrove upstream API circuit breaker, confirm the support team can force the breaker open during a full outage. The override bundle lives in the sealed escrow drawer and is useless without its unlock phrase. Two ceremony witnesses must initial this step before proceeding. The escrow bundle is decrypted with the recovery passphrase that follows.

vault phrase of kahip-kahop = holath-quenmir

## Step 4: Enable hot-reload in Kettleworth

Okay, this is the fun part. Old Kettleworth needed a full restart for any config change, which is why deploys were such a pain. The new watcher picks up edits within a couple of seconds — no restart, no dropped connections. One gotcha: malformed files are rejected and the last good config stays live, so check the logs if a change doesn't seem to take. Start by replacing your existing file with these baseline values:

deployment values, kajep-kageg:
[praix]
host = praix.paliqcorp.corp
user = praix_svc
database = praix_prod